Key Responsibilities
  • Conduct Planned Preventative Maintenance (PPM) on electrical systems and equipment.
  • Respond promptly to breakdowns and perform reactive maintenance tasks.
  • Undertake minor installation tasks, including minor projects related to power supply, lighting, power distribution, etc.
  • Troubleshoot and diagnose electrical faults, ensuring timely repairs.
  • Ensure compliance with health and safety regulations at all times.
  • Maintain accurate records of maintenance activities and report findings.
  • Collaborate with colleagues to ensure efficient and effective maintenance operations.
Qualifications and Requirements
  • Fully qualified with an NVQ Level 3 or City and Guilds in Electrical Installation.
  • Possess an AM2 (Achievement Measurement 2) certificate.
  • Up‑to‑date knowledge of the 18th Edition Wiring Regulations.
  • Proven experience in electrical maintenance and repair.
  • Strong problem‑solving skills and attention to detail.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
  • A valid UK driver’s licence is essential, as this role involves travel between sites.
